Description
Aiming to improve our understanding of the spatial distribution of Galactic HII regions we have started a program with the integral field spectrometer SINFONI on the ESO-VLT (Very Large Telescope) Yepun to observe obscured stellar clusters in HII regions. Through the detection and spectral classification of individual cluster stars we are able to obtain a complete census of the nature of the brightest stars and to obtain a spectrophotometric distance to the cluster. Such distance estimates are independent and complementary to kinematic distances and free from the ambiguity inherent to the latters' determination. Most importantly, our method is based on near-infrared observations, which are much less limited by interstellar extinction than previous optical programmes, allowing studies along lines of sight where optical measurements are impossible
